Pontos calculates distance matrices from DNA sequence alignments.
Pontos is an easy-to-use, graphical Java program for the calculation of uncorrected distance (or similarity) matrices from DNA sequence alignments in PHYLIP format. It also creates "difference" alignments from regular ones (and vice-versa).
It can handle gaps and ambiguities in different ways.
Gaps can be:
- all used;
- all ignored;
- ignored only at the ends of the sequences, in a pairwise manner;

Add-on to Haploview that picks tagSNPs while allowing for: (1) preferential selection based on user-defined criteria, (2) selection across multiple populations, (3) selection outside defined genomic regions, and (4) picking of surrogate (backup) tagSNPs.
A general purpose distributed hash table adapted for sequence analysis. This program searches for all maximal, exact unique n-mers from a given set of genomes. Originally, this program's primary use was to design resequencing microarrays.

A plugin for the VANTED system, called Glyph-based Link Exploration of Pathways (GLIEP). It helps to guide the navigation and exploration process of interconnected pathway visualization as well as insight into the overall interconnectivity.
3D Genome Tuner draws circular genome map and enables viewing multi-genomes in 3D context. It also provides genome analysis and sequence alignment, making it a powerful tool in genome studies and demonstrations.
The program versusSNP is a flexible tool for mining SNPs between two close related genomes. First, we align all the orthologous genes and select SNPs, then the SNPs are separated into categories based on their mutation types.

Knime (http://www.knime.org) nodes for sequence bioinformatics. Sequime is an eclipse plug-in for the KNIME data mining platform, providing additional nodes for reading, processing and visualizing sequence information.
PhyloSort sorts phylogenetic trees by searching for user-specified subtrees that contain a monophyletic group of interest defined by operational taxonomic units.
TMAJ is software for Tissue MicroArrays (TMA's). Patients, specimens, blocks, slides, cores, images, and scores can all be stored and viewed. Features include advanced security, custom dynamic fields, and an image analysis program.
The BioSimz project aims to deliver a library (as well as the interface) to conduct large-scale biomolecular simulations at their atomic scales of detail. The initiative idea is to observe the protein crowding in vivo; it now can do much more than that!
h2:www is an easily extendable online interface for bioinformatical command-line tools, providing convenient project-oriented working facilities for multiple users.

QSAR is a project that aims to build a GUI that enables people to build quantitative structure activity (or property) relationship models. It will use parts of CDK (cdk.sf.net), JOELib (joelib.sf.net), R (www.r-project.org) and other projects.
